Riyadh - 1:45 pm | Thunder clouds advancing towards the capital, coming from the west, may be accompanied by downy winds and dust

<p style=";text-align:left;direction:ltr">Weather of Arabia - Sinan Khalaf - The weather forecast staff at the &quot;Arab Regional Weather Center&quot; monitors large amounts of cumulonimbus thunderstorms that formed to the west of the city of Riyadh.</p><p style=";text-align:left;direction:ltr"></p><p style=";text-align:left;direction:ltr"> Satellite images indicate that these clouds are moving to the east directly towards the capital, which raises the possibility that the capital will be affected by thunderstorms of varying intensity in the next hour.</p><p style=";text-align:left;direction:ltr"></p><p style=";text-align:left;direction:ltr"> It is not excluded that the city of Riyadh will be affected by a wave of dust as a result of the rush of downward winds from these clouds, which may lead to a decrease in the horizontal visibility, so please take caution and caution.</p><p style=";text-align:left;direction:ltr"></p><p style=";text-align:left;direction:ltr"></p>
